An Introduction to Thermal Scopes
The background of thermal scopes goes through the middle of the 20th century during the height of the Cold War. They were initially designed for military use, these devices were designed to identify heat signatures, thereby providing a significant advantage in low-visibility environments. Over the years technological advances have enabled thermal scopes to become more easily accessible and versatile, leading to their wide-spread use in the present. Understanding Thermal Scopes
So, how do thermal scopes function? In their fundamentals, thermal scopes are able to detect infrared radiation which all objects emit. The radiation is converted into an electronic signal, which is processed to create the thermal image. The image appears in different color palettes, with different shades representing different temperatures. Several thermal scopes are available in the market with unique specifications and features.
Some are designed specifically for certain applications, like hunting, or for home inspections whereas others are more adaptable. Take into consideration factors like resolution and detection range, as well as refresh rate and battery life when deciding on the right thermal scope.
